WT_SESSION environment variable is set by Windows Terminal to a GUID that uniquely identifies the current terminal session. A companion variable, WT_PROFILE_ID, identifies the Windows Terminal profile that launched the shell.
Applications use WT_SESSION as the canonical way to detect Windows Terminal, since older versions did not set TERM_PROGRAM and the TERM value on Windows is typically inherited from the underlying console host rather than chosen by Windows Terminal itself.How this is testedmanual
